54 JUNE 22-28, 2023 miaminewtimes.com | browardpalmbeach.com NEW TIMES B E S T O F M I A M I ® 2 0 2 3 B E S T P L AC E TO R O L L E R - S K AT E Beachwalk Miami Beach Running the entire waterfront length of the beachfront from South Pointe Park to 87th Terrace at the tippy-top of the Miami Beach city limits, a seven-mile Beachwalk path boasts scenic views of the ocean, sand, whim- sical lifeguard stands, and the tanned and sweaty cast of locals and tourists. Bonus: There are plenty of water fountains, public re- strooms, and benches along the way. If you get too hot, take a shower or a dip in the beckon- ing, briny sea. B E S T U R B A N B I K E R I D E Commodore Trail commodoretrail.us The Commodore Trail offers cyclists, from ca- sual riders to professionals, five miles of lush vegetation and waterfront views through Co- conut Grove and Coral Gables. The trail begins at Alice Wainright Park on S. Miami Avenue near the mouth of the Rickenbacker Causeway and ends at the Cocoplum roundabout at Old Cutler Road. Along the trail are numerous points of interest for bike riders, including public parks (Kennedy and Peacock), historic landmarks (Vizcaya Museum & Gardens, the Barnacle Historic State Park, the Kampong), and Coconut Grove shops offering coffee, snacks, and other energizing treats. B E S T B A S K E T B A L L CO U R T S Flamingo Park 1200 Meridian Avenue Miami Beach, 33139 miamibeachfl .gov/city-hall/parks-and-recreation/ parks-facilities-directory/facility-info-fl amingo- park The courts at Venice Beach in LA might be one of the holiest spots for pickup basketball in the world. Flamingo Park is Miami’s version of Venice Beach, and though it might be a few blocks further from the ocean, the authentic, sweaty vibe is the same. You can find a game pretty much any time of the day and year. The baskets on the two full courts are equipped with glass backboards with breakaway rims. One amenity that Flamingo Park can lord over Venice Beach is its lights, which illuminate the courts after dark. So in those summer months when it’s too hot to play in the afternoon, you can still shoot hoops until 10 p.m. each and ev- ery night. B E S T G O L F CO U R S E Miami Beach Golf Club 2301 Alton Road Miami Beach, 33140 305-532-3350 miamibeachgolfclub.com Nestled between the Atlantic Ocean and Bis- cayne Bay lies a stunning stretch of manicured greenery seemingly dropped from the heav- ens. The Miami Beach Golf Club is not only beloved by locals but is considered one of the finest links in the nation. Following years of multimillion-dollar renovations and diligent upkeep, the course is nigh immaculate. If you get peckish from repeatedly striking a small, dimpled ball in the South Florida sun, the club offers breakfast, lunch, and dinner to keep you off the couch and on the green. (Or, if you golf like we do, in the rough.) B E S T T E N N I S CO U R T S Biltmore Tennis Center 1150 Anastasia Avenue Coral Gables, 33134 305-460-5360 coralgables.com/department/community-recre- ation/biltmore-tennis-center “Wait,” you say. “There are tennis courts at the Biltmore, and a regular Joe Schmoe like me can play there?” Yes, and yes. The beauty of these ten hard courts, tucked in the eastern shadow of the eponymous Coral Gables resort, is in their ample spacing and the range of skills on display. Whether you’re a budding Coco Gauff or just learning to step into and follow through on that improving forehand, the Bilt- more Tennis Center will accommodate your skill (or lack thereof). Of course, you’ll want to snag a reservation ahead of time; the center of- fers an hourly rate in the $5-to-$8 range if you’re a Miami-Dade County resident. B E S T G Y M Muscle Beach South Beach 873 Ocean Drive Miami Beach, 33139 @musclebeachsouthbeach (Instagram) Do you want to get shredded but can’t afford the dues? Do you prefer to pair your reps with the great outdoors? Do you like to finish each workout with a dip in the Atlantic Ocean? If you answered yes to any or all of these ques- tions, well, Muscle Beach South Beach is for you.
